Position Overview:

Responsible for leading and managing staff in charge of complex projects and communications supporting regional, operating unit or system-wide goals and initiatives. Oversees resource and time management initiatives and applications, and manages the intake and delivery of projects for the team. Provides mentoring to project team members in regards to departmental, organizational and personnel issues and serves as a resource for change management, staff development and cross training. Collaborates with leaders and sponsors regarding process and system improvements that assist the business in achieving its goals and objectives, leveraging best practices and professional experience. Provides coaching and support to Project Managers and Coordinators; completes issue identification, assessment, and resolution; provides technical support in order to achieve desired outcomes and compliance with Sutter Health policies/procedures and standards.

SKILLS AND KNOWLEDGE:
Thorough knowledge of the project management processes, including planning tasks and allocating resources, risk management, issues management, time management, financial management, quality management, monitoring and reporting, documentation, and record keeping.

Extensive business knowledge sufficient to understand the operations and technical issues involved with the project and industry, to be able to anticipate and identify obstacles, and make accurate decisions and recommendations.

Ability to provide direction, monitor, train, coach, and assign work to project staff.

Interpersonal skills: the ability to work well with people from many different disciplines with varying degrees of experience; competence in clear, concise, and tactful communication with management, vendors, peers, and staff.

Adaptability and flexibility, including the ability to manage deadline pressure, ambiguity, and change.

Ability to plan and facilitate meetings.

Thorough knowledge of principles of Lean management systems.

The ability to gain cooperation and support through effective use of influence and persuasion is required.

Conceptual, analytical, and negotiation skills are necessary, along with the ability to solve moderately complex problems and develop actionable recommendations.
